Prepares the initialization transaction for a contract deployment
function getInitializeTransaction(options: {  chain: Readonly;  implementationContract: Readonly;  initializeParams?: Record<string, unknown>;  modules?: Array<{    initializeParams?: Record<string, unknown>;  }>;}): Promise<>;The options for generating the initialize transaction
let options: {  chain: Readonly;  implementationContract: Readonly;  initializeParams?: Record<string, unknown>;  modules?: Array<{    initializeParams?: Record<string, unknown>;  }>;};let returnType: Readonly<options> & {  __preparedMethod?: () => Promise<PreparedMethod<abiFn>>;};The prepared transaction for contract initialization